Why China Needs So Many Software Architects: A Policy‑Driven Analysis
The article examines why China’s digital‑economy strategy, technology‑sovereignty goals, the Xinchuang initiative, widespread digital transformation, and a severe talent gap are driving an unprecedented demand for software architects, and it offers policy‑aware career recommendations.
1. Phenomenon
“Architect” appears increasingly in media, policy documents, recruitment ads, and training programs.
2. Digital‑economy demand
2.1 National strategy
Since 2020 the “new‑infrastructure” strategy emphasizes 5G, big‑data centers, AI, and industrial internet; all depend on software systems whose core is architecture. The 2021 14th Five‑Year Plan calls for accelerating digitalisation, building Digital China, and deep integration of digital and real economies.
2.2 Software “eating the world”
Everyday apps such as Meituan, Ele.me, Didi, subway apps, Taobao, JD.com, WeChat, Alipay, and Douyin are built on complex software systems that require architects.
3. Technology sovereignty from the US‑China trade conflict
3.1 Lessons from “being choked”
Since 2018 the trade war caused chip supply cuts to Huawei, threats to TikTok, and multiple entity‑list restrictions, leading to the conclusion that core technologies must be independently controllable.
3.2 Strategic role of architects
Core technologies—chips, operating systems, databases, middleware—need architectural design; without it a country can only patch existing solutions.
4. “Xinchuang” (Information Technology Innovation) momentum
4.1 Definition
Xinchuang means replacing imported IT with domestic alternatives; the state pushes it in government, state‑owned enterprises, and finance.
4.2 Opportunities for architects
Xinchuang projects require redesigning whole architectures to accommodate domestic chips, operating systems, databases, and middleware. Architects must understand the domestic stack, perform technology selection, and design Xinchuang solutions.
5. Digital‑transformation wave
5.1 Enterprise scope
Manufacturing (smart factories, industrial internet), retail (online‑offline integration, new retail), finance (fintech, digital banking), and healthcare (internet medical, health big data) are all undergoing digital transformation.
5.2 Architectural requirements
Transformation needs overall IT architecture planning, business‑system design, data‑architecture governance, and technology‑architecture evolution; lacking architectural thinking leads to project failure.
6. Talent gap
6.1 Supply‑demand imbalance
Ministry of Industry and Information Technology data: over 7 million software workers in China, fewer than 10 % are architects, while estimated demand may exceed 1 million, driving up salaries.
6.2 Long cultivation cycle
Becoming an architect typically requires 5–10 years of technical accumulation, experience on multiple large projects, and continuous learning.
7. Policy support and professional certification
7.1 Inclusion in the national qualification system
The senior “System Architecture Designer” credential is part of the Computer Technology and Software Professional Qualification (软考) and is recognized by state‑owned enterprises for title promotion, tax deduction, and city‑level settlement points.
7.2 Government backing
2020 “Opinions on Deepening Title‑System Reform” and provincial measures grant benefits to holders of senior engineering titles and require the certificate for certain bidding projects.
8. Industry outlook
8.1 Sectors with highest architect demand
Internet – ★★★★★ – high business complexity, fast tech iteration
FinTech – ★★★★★ – stringent security and stability requirements
Smart manufacturing – ★★★★ – large digital‑transformation needs
Government / state‑owned enterprises – ★★★★ – Xinchuang retrofits and digital governance
Healthcare – ★★★ – rapid growth of internet medical services
